Summary
Billy Ray Cyrus said he is "all good" with Miley Cyrus releasing her upcoming album as "just Miley," calling the name change a "natural progression."
Instagram was his venue for clearing the air, where he said he had always called her Miley and told her directly he supported the shift.
Cyrus tied the moment to celebrity single-name branding, citing Dolly, Cher, Elvis and Prince, while joking that his own career might have looked different without "Billy Ray."
Miley, born Destiny Hope Cyrus, legally became Miley Ray Cyrus in 2008; her new album "Bass Persuades" is due Sept. 18.
